Ubisoft shares fell on Thursday after the company warned of further losses in the current fiscal year. The French video game publisher, best known for the Assassin’s Creed franchise, faces ongoing headwinds in a competitive gaming market.

Ubisoft’s stock declined sharply on Thursday following the company’s public warning that it anticipates additional losses this year. The announcement signals continued financial pressure for the game developer, which has been grappling with shifting industry dynamics and product delays. The warning comes after a period of restructuring efforts and cost-cutting measures intended to improve profitability. The company did not provide specific quarterly figures or a precise loss forecast, but the cautious outlook prompted a negative market reaction. Ubisoft has recently released several major titles, including the latest instalment in the Assassin’s Creed series, yet the overall financial performance has not met management’s earlier expectations. The warning may reflect broader challenges in the video game sector, including increased competition from mobile gaming, subscription services, and a slowdown in post-pandemic consumer spending on high-budget titles. Ubisoft’s management has previously acknowledged the need to streamline operations and refocus on its biggest franchises. The latest warning suggests that these efforts have not yet reversed the company’s financial trajectory. Market data indicates that investor sentiment turned cautious after the announcement, with the stock seeing high volume during Thursday’s trading session. From a professional perspective, Ubisoft’s latest warning suggests that the company’s turnaround plan may take longer than previously anticipated. While the Assassin’s Creed brand remains a valuable asset, the overall game development environment has become more challenging, with rising costs and longer development timelines. The company’s ability to generate sustainable profits may depend on the success of upcoming titles in its pipeline, as well as its capacity to expand into growing segments such as mobile gaming. Investor caution is understandable in light of the warning. However, it is important to note that the gaming industry is cyclical, and a recovery could occur if Ubisoft delivers strong performances from its core franchises or successfully enters new markets. Analysts will likely focus on the company’s next earnings release for more clarity on cash flow, cost reduction progress, and any updates on major projects. Until then, the stock may remain under pressure from uncertainty about the timing and magnitude of future losses.
